John hersey 1914 1993 john richard hersey june 17, 1914march 24, 1993 was an american writer and journalist. Name of writer, number pages in ebook and size are given in our post. Hersey was born in tientsin, china, 3 the son of grace baird and roscoe hersey, protestant missionaries for the young mens christian association in tientsin. A bell for adano, novel by john hersey, published in 1944 and awarded a pulitzer prize in 1945 the novels action takes place during world war ii after the occupation of sicily by allied forces. John richard hersey was a pulitzer prizewinning american writer and journalist considered one of the earliest practitioners of the socalled new journalism, in which storytelling devices of the novel are fused with nonfiction reportage.
